Reading comprehension is foundational to lifelong learning, and understanding vowel teams is crucial for children ages 4-7, who are in the early stages of reading development. Vowel teams, also known as digraphs (like "ea" in "bread" or "ee" in "tree"), help young readers decode words more quickly and accurately, thereby enhancing their reading fluency and comprehension. When children grasp vowel teams, they can read more varied and complex texts, which exposes them to a richer vocabulary and broader concepts.
For parents and teachers, investing time in teaching normal vowel teams pays dividends in multiple ways. First, improved reading skills boost confidence in young learners, fostering a positive attitude towards reading and learning in general. Furthermore, strong reading comprehension is linked to better performance in all academic subjects, as it aids in the understanding of instructions and subject material in areas like math, science, and social studies.
Lastly, mastering vowel teams early on helps in identifying patterns in English spelling and pronunciation, making the overall learning process smoother and less frustrating for children. Engaging activities, repetitive practice, and positive reinforcement can make this learning both fun and effective, setting the stage for a lifelong love of reading.
